高中物理选修3-1对电容器作了如下描述:“实验表明:一个电容器所带的电荷量Q与电容器两极的电势差U成正比,比值是一个常数。”教师教学用书上介绍了“利用电容器放电测电容”和“用传感器做定量实验学习电容器的概念”2种方法,但都是用I-t图象求“面积”的方法求Q。由于电容器的带电量很难准确测量,教学效果不是很理想。为此,笔者介绍一种自制“恒定电流源”方法:指的是在一定的条
